Transaction 45c490145d40d38148c8757df81286e3b2bd34ef574700a08b75dbcbbd158637
1 Input
2 Outputs
- 45c490145d40d38148c8757df81286e3b2bd34ef574700a08b75dbcbbd158637:0
- 45c490145d40d38148c8757df81286e3b2bd34ef574700a08b75dbcbbd158637:1
value 100102
address 3MKaTNDSnbzqqYPEF6ebGQ6f9PnNLMAoQQ
value 1229533
address 34JiENaYLpV1UqCBog9UpxpK3kJgTXUGdP